Must have
Subject has a confirmed diagnosis of multiple myeloma as specified by the International Myeloma Working Group criteria and must have measurable disease as defined by at least one of the following criteria: Serum monoclonal protein ≥ 0.5 g/dL, ≥200 mg of monoclonal protein in the urine on 24-hour electrophoresis, Serum immunoglobulin free light chain: involved FLC ≥ 10 mg/dL (≥ 100 mg/L) AND abnormal serum immunoglobulin kappa to lambda free light chain ratio
Subjects must have completed any 'induction therapy' and have achieved less than a complete response (CR).
Must not have
Subject has received radiation therapy within 3 weeks of enrollment Enrollment of subjects who require concurrent radiotherapy (which must be localized in its field size) should be deferred until the radiotherapy is completed and 3 weeks have elapsed since the last date of therapy.
Subject has concurrent, uncontrolled medical condition, laboratory abnormality, or psychiatric illness which could place him/her at unacceptable risk, including, but not limited to, uncontrolled hypertension, uncontrolled diabetes, active uncontrolled infection, and/or acute chronic liver disease (i.e., hepatitis, cirrhosis).

Summary

This trial is testing a new cancer drug, Carfilzomib, given with other drugs, to see what dose is safe for people.

Who is the study for?
This trial is for adults over 18 with multiple myeloma who have had some treatment but not a complete response. They should expect to live more than 12 weeks, be in fairly good health with normal liver function and heart performance, and have an acceptable blood count. Women must test negative for pregnancy and agree to use contraception, as must men.
What is being tested?
The study tests different doses of Carfilzomib (20-70mg/m2) combined with Cyclophosphamide, Dexamethasone, and G-CSF in escalating groups using a '3+3 design' to find the best dose for stem cell transplant preparation in multiple myeloma patients.
What are the potential side effects?
Carfilzomib may cause fatigue, nausea, shortness of breath, fever, and risk of infection. It can also affect blood pressure and heart rhythm. Side effects from Cyclophosphamide include hair loss, mouth sores while Dexamethasone can cause weight gain and mood swings.

Trial Design

6Treatment groups
Experimental Treatment
Group I: Carfilzomib Mobilization - Dose Level 5Experimental Treatment4 Interventions
Carfilzomib at 70mg/m2 over 30 minutes will be administered concomitantly with Cyclophosphamide 2 gm/m2, Dexamethasone 40mg and G-CSF. For patients who are naïve to carfilzomib based therapy a priming dose of Carfilzomib (20mg/m2) will be administered 1 week prior to the cohort dosing.
Group II: Carfilzomib Mobilization - Dose Level 4Experimental Treatment4 Interventions
Carfilzomib at 56mg/m2 over 30 minutes will be administered concomitantly with Cyclophosphamide 2 gm/m2, Dexamethasone 40mg and G-CSF. For patients who are naïve to carfilzomib based therapy a priming dose of Carfilzomib (20mg/m2) will be administered 1 week prior to the cohort dosing.
Group III: Carfilzomib Mobilization - Dose Level 3Experimental Treatment4 Interventions
Carfilzomib at 45mg/m2 over 30 minutes will be administered concomitantly with Cyclophosphamide 2 gm/m2, Dexamethasone 40mg and G-CSF. For patients who are naïve to carfilzomib based therapy a priming dose of Carfilzomib (20mg/m2) will be administered 1 week prior to the cohort dosing.
Group IV: Carfilzomib Mobilization - Dose Level 2Experimental Treatment4 Interventions
Carfilzomib at 36mg/m2 over 30 minutes will be administered concomitantly with Cyclophosphamide 2 gm/m2, Dexamethasone 40mg and G-CSF. For patients who are naïve to carfilzomib based therapy a priming dose of Carfilzomib (20mg/m2) will be administered 1 week prior to the cohort dosing.
Group V: Carfilzomib Mobilization - Dose Level 1Experimental Treatment4 Interventions
Carfilzomib at 27mg/m2 over 10 minutes will be administered concomitantly with Cyclophosphamide 2 gm/m2, Dexamethasone 40mg and G-CSF. For patients who are naïve to carfilzomib based therapy a priming dose of Carfilzomib (20mg/m2) will be administered 1 week prior to the cohort dosing.
Group VI: Carfilzomib Mobilization - Dose Level 0Experimental Treatment4 Interventions
Carfilzomib at 20mg/m2 over 10 minutes will be administered concomitantly with Cyclophosphamide 2 gm/m2, Dexamethasone 40mg and G-CSF. For patients who are naïve to carfilzomib based therapy a priming dose of Carfilzomib (20mg/m2) will be administered 1 week prior to the cohort dosing.
